I'm currently looking at what we're going to do as far as
extension points go to enable folks to contribute e4 (DI)
code into the IDE and I want to get some feedback from the
e4 community as to the best way for me to do this...
I have two possible approaches:
1) Extend the current IDE extension points with e4-specific
sections (i.e. extend the existing org.eclipse.ui.views EP
to allow the addition of 'e4 View')
2) Provide separate extension points for the e4 bits (i.e.
clone the existing org.eclipse.ui.views EP and tweak it to
be e4-related
Do you *want* e4 specific extension points ? This is
independent of having the ability to contribute them through
fragment / model processing (which we'll also be working on
in Luna). The BOF at last year's eclipsecon didn't come to a
resolution on this (at least not one that I remember..;-).
